This gold cushion cased Buren Grand Prix has a nice ICI inscription on the case back.

HOW DO WE DATE THIS WATCH?

From the presentation engraving on the case back we can accurately date this watch to being awarded to J. W. Earle for thirty years service to Imperial Chemical Industries Ltd in 1951.  The Birmingham hallmark for 1951 is also inside the case back.

CONDITION

Buren were a well respected watchmaker, who among the likes of JLC, IWC and Omega made some of the dirty dozen military watches from 1944.  The hand wound, 17 jewel movement is stamped for Buren Grand Prix, and starts immediately and continues to run well.  The case is made by Dennison, and the case back matches the main case number too.  There is a dent on the case back, but it doesn’t interfere with the watch working, as well as signs of wear on the front of the case too.  In the early fifties many people smoked, and this could cause damage to many a watch dial, but this seems to have survived well -you can see the patina of age, but many watches would be far worse.  The case has fixed bars, which are not bent or distorted.  The leather strap is new, and could be swapped for a different colour if preferred.
